## PickPath Optimizer — Who to Ask

Building a plugin for the PickPath Optimizer? Great — the extension API is documented on the Devpages wiki, but real humans are better for the tricky bits. Routing heuristics go to the Warehouse Algorithms squad; slotting and bin-weight questions go to Marla Teague's crew. For anything plugin-related, including sandbox access and review timelines, reach the integrations desk here.

escalation mailbox, kagep-tawef: ulawyn_norius_gordor@paliqlabs.corp

GridForge onboarding, reviewer notes. The crossword generator lives in /gen; solver heuristics in /fill. PRs must pass the clue-dedup check before review. Local runs need the Lexomatic word-bank service, which requires an API credential scoped to staging only. Copy .env.sample to .env, keep defaults for grid size and symmetry. Never commit the filled .env. Add the Lexomatic credential on the line directly below this comment.

vault entry, tagug-tawef: LEDGER_TOKEN5=8573d

Vaultspin is our internal secrets-rotation utility. Support staff will mostly interact with it when a customer-facing service reports an auth failure after a scheduled rotation. Rotations run nightly at 02:00 and are logged to the Vaultspin audit channel. If a rotation partially fails, Vaultspin rolls the affected secret back automatically and opens a ticket. You do not need production access to check rotation status; the read-only dashboard covers it. Rotation manifests are validated against the key that follows.

deploy key for kajof-fajop: bky6_gDHw9Q

Ticket: Staging env misconfigured for Siftgate bloom filter

The bloom layer in front of the Pellet KV store is rejecting all lookups in staging because the env file was copied from the dev template without credentials. False-positive tuning values are fine; only the auth line is missing. To unblock the weekly demo, the Pellet admission secret must be set on the following line.

env line for yaguf-fajop: LEDGER_TOKEN13=fb08984397349